Course Description
Course Profile
Architecture and Urban Planning is a new professional programme focused on the digital design and crucial aspects of Architecture for Society of Knowledge [ASK]. In part, it is remotely delivered over the Internet and requires a limited, one-semester residency period during its core program. It can be completed in 18 months and concludes with a Master of Architecture degree in the field of Architecture and Urban Planning. Students can investigate contemporary design practices as well as media and digital technologies relevant to the emerging 21st century city. Full EU tuition scholarships are available for the initial group of competitively admitted international students. ASK [Architecture for Society of Knowledge] is dedicated to those who wish to extend their practical understanding of contemporary architecture and urban planning. The program addresses digital media in design, prototyping with computer controlled machines, distributed design collaboration, and agendas for sustainable, intelligent building. At the same time, it reflects on architectural basics: cultural heritage, history and theory paradigms, social aspects of space creation, and education through interacting space. The ASK Program aims to equip young practicing architects with the formative experience required in:
- active participation in the global architectural knowledge society, and critical interpretation of the creative aspects of design and design collaboration,
- collaborative and interdisciplinary practice of architecture,
- architectural research exploring new design technology and theory.
